CMA specialises in the hotel, restaurant, leisure and tourism industries. Services include hotel and restaurant feasibility studies and market planning reviews; catering development and operating assessments; leisure and health & fitness site and business reviews; operator assessments and business coaching.

CMA was initially based on the 17 years operating experience gained by Chris Morton running hotels, restaurants, bars, health and fitness clubs, catering services at a number of conference and exhibition centres and outside catering operations.

Within this period Chris managed two London based restaurant groups operating a range of restaurants from a 1 star Michelin restaurant to a range of popular eating houses, opened one of the UK’s first health and fitness centres, managed a 3 Star hotel and took it to a 4 star status, developed a conference & exhibition catering division and managed a growing 11 unit hotel company.

In 1994 Chris joined international hotel & tourism consultants Pannell Kerr Forster Associates and spent three years undertaking hotel feasibility studies on four different continents.

Finally, Chris has worked closely with the International Oil Pollution Compensation Fund for more than 16 years assisting them to gauge the impact of oil spills on tourism businesses and assessing the levels of economic loss suffered by individual businesses. This work has included area and business assessments in the UK, France, Spain, Japan, the Philippines and S Korea.
